The Rubik’s Cube is a mechanical puzzle invented in 1974 by Hungarian sculptor and architecture teacher Ernő Rubik. The puzzle is a 3x3x3 plastic cube with 54 visible colored stickers. The faces of a large cube are capable of rotating around the 3 internal axes of the cube. The name Rubik’s Cube is accepted in most languages ​​of the world, with the exception of German and Chinese, where its original name Magic Cube remains common.
